Summary

LEE-ROWAN COMPANY has accumulated 15 OSHA violations across 7 inspections over 39 years of recorded history, with $3,413 in total assessed penalties.

The establishment sits in the 96th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 39,937 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 99th perc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 27 years ago.

Federal records were found in 1 of 15 sources. Sources without matching records returned empty for this establishment.
